Binary package hint: linux-source-2.6.22
Suspend to RAM doesn't work sometimes, but I couldn't find out when.
Looks like it's hanging randomly when returning from suspend. It used to
work right all the time in Feisty, and now Hibernate still works
flawlessly.
I've tried to get more info following the page DebuggingKernelSuspend on the
wiki, but with this method, I could'nt get a crash (maybe because it's related
or because it's random - I'll try more). Still in dmesg I've found this (see
attached):
kernel: [ 10.565517] Magic number: 7:915:530
I use Gutsy since kernel 2.6.22-12 I guess ('ls /boot/').
$ uname -r
2.6.22-13-generic
I could not find a duplicate but I cruelly lack more information to
check, what should I do more?
